Greek Chicken Soup

Meal Items

fat free chicken broth

1½ cup(s)

raw egg

1 large

mineral water

1 tsp

fresh lemon juice

2 Tbsp

cooked skinless boneless chicken breast

½ cup(s), (diced)

cooked carrots

½ cup(s), (diced)

chives

1 tbsp(s), (fresh, minced)

table salt

tsp, (or to taste)

black pepper

tsp, (or to taste)

Notes

Bring broth to a simmer in a medium pot. Meanwhile, beat together egg, water and lemon juice in a heatproof bowl. Whisking constantly, pour half of simmered broth into egg mixture. Slowly pour all of egg mixture into pot (with remaining broth), whisking constantly to prevent curdling. Add chicken, carrots, chives, salt and pepper. Heat soup over very low heat until contents are hot and broth is slightly thickened, stirring constantly. (PREP TIP: This is one of the most famous dishes in Greek cuisine but one of the trickiest. For an easy variation, stir 1 tablespoon of flour – 1/2 PointsPlus value – into 1/4 cup of chicken broth in a pot over medium heat. Add the remaining 1 1/4 cups of broth and cook, stirring, until slightly thickened. Add the lemon juice, chicken, carrots, chives, salt and pepper; heat through. You are omitting the egg.)
